Yes. People generally have a perception that walking foot is only used for straight stitching. But, it can be used for other stitches as well, like zigzag pattern. As the zigzag pattern has forward stitches, you can easily use a walking foot to sew it. You also have to sew some … WebJan 17, 2024 · 2. Try sewing with a very narrow zigzag stitch – but for this, you must make sure your machine can use a zigzag stitch with the twin needle. The stitch should fit inside the zigzag foot opening and the needles should fit exactly in the center of the presser foot hole. If there is an offset from the center, then the double-needle may break.

The LX3817 is perfect for everyday sewing and mending. WebApr 11, 2024 · First: you’ve got to use a walking foot. This will help feed all three layers of the quilt through the machine consistently. If you don’t use one, the backing of the quilt is going to be pushed through a lot faster than the top and it’s just going to get real messy, real quick. ...
